Definition of Haywire
Haywire
hay·wire


Definition/Meaning
(adverb)
being out of order or having gone terribly wrong, out of control;

e.g. The malfunction caused the tractor to go haywire and crash into the barn.

(adjective)
emotionally or mentally upset;

e.g. Her haywire emotions were causing disruption in her life.
